Why Does My Ring Doorbell keep going offline?
If your Ring Doorbell keeps going offline, it’s generally one of four common issues: what lies between your camera and router, Wi-Fi connectivity issues, power surges, and low battery. Other occurrences can create connection issues and cause your Ring Doorbell to lose connection, but they are not as typical.

How do I get my Ring back online?
How to Reconnect Your Ring Doorbell or Security Camera to Wifi or Change Your Wifi Network
- Tap on the three lines on the top left.
- Tap Devices.
- Select doorbell or security camera you need to reconnect to wifi. The next screen is the Device Dashboard.
- Tap on Device Health.
- Tap on Reconnect to Wifi or Change Wifi Network.

Why has my Ring Doorbell stopped working?
Unplug your router for 30 seconds and then plug it back in. See if your Ring Doorbell automatically reconnects. Turn off the power to your Ring Pro at the breaker box for 30 seconds, then turn it back on.If all else fails, check to make sure your Ring Pro is getting sufficient power.

Can a doorbell go bad?
If there is no sound you have three possible problems: a bad transformer, a bad doorbell, or broken wires in-between.If it rings, your problem is in the wires between the button and the transformer. If it does not, you could have a bad transformer or a bad doorbell.
How do I test my ring doorbell Wi-Fi?
To check the strength of your wifi signal, do the following:
- Open your Ring app.
- Tap on the three lines on the top left of the screen.
- Select Devices.
- Tap on the Ring device you would like to test.
- Tap on the Device Health tile.
- On the Device Health screen, look at your Signal Strength under the Network section.

Does ring doorbell work without Internet?
Unfortunately no, Ring does not allow you to have a cellular backup on your doorbells and cameras. If your internet or Wi-Fi goes out, they will not be able to operate without an internet connection and there is no option to replace said connection with a cellular backup.
